Transaction 52459396a5e5339d4a880e96abb323dd7aaad0a64e28702322d8e0a809685991
1 Input
1 Output
-
52459396a5e5339d4a880e96abb323dd7aaad0a64e28702322d8e0a809685991:0
- value
- 23251753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46b0dc18fe923533d30f21da53a38b68d0940c15 OP_EQUAL
- address
- 388o6QLaNKLV3G3Drk8VUXqq5RqKc9N9Lu